
Rancho Piccolo Organic Farm is tucked into California, on the outskirts of Atwater. It's one of a handful of working apple farms in this part of the state that still opens the rows to visitors each fall.
From Atwater center, 1120 Commerce Ave is a short drive on county roads. Weekend traffic can back up near the entrance on peak fall Saturdays, arriving before 11 a.m. usually skips the wait.

Pick-your-own is available at Rancho Piccolo Organic Farm during the harvest window. Guests walk the rows, pick straight from the tree, and settle up at the farm stand.
Apple season at Rancho Piccolo Organic Farm tracks the rest of California. Most fruit ripens between late August and late October. If you can only make one trip, late September through early October gives you the best odds of finding both early and mid-season apples on the trees at the same time.
Saturdays fill up fast once the first frost hits. Sunday afternoons and any weekday morning are noticeably calmer if you'd rather not queue at the register.
